Sounds to me as if the radio and radio antenna are providing a
significant path between the Univolt or battery and ground. The antenna
is grounded to the shell. Burning off the antenna lead didn't come from
heat from the radio, it came from excess current from that significant
path. The ground lead from either the battery or the Univolt is
connected only or mostly to the radio while the other is connected to
the frame and aluminum shell. That's also why it fried the filter
without blowing the fuse. The excess current was in the ground lead, not
the power lead.
